What is incontinence during pregnancy? Urinary incontinence happens when you have trouble controlling your bladder. If you experience incontinence, you might feel an urgent need to pee, or you may leak urine (pee) between trips to the bathroom. You may also find yourself making more frequent trips to the toilet. Bladder control problems happen for many reasons, including pregnancy and childbirth.
